War of the Worlds (2019 TV series)

War of the Worlds is a television series produced by Fox Networks Group and StudioCanal-backed Urban Myth Films. The series is written by Howard Overman, and directed by Gilles Coulier and Richard Clark. The series is a loose adaptation of the H.G. Wells 1898 novel of the same name, and is the third television adaptation of the Wells Martian invasion novel. War of the Worlds consists of eight episodes, and first premiered in France on October 28, 2019. It has been renewed for a second season.[1]

Premise

The series takes place in present-day Europe, but it serves as a re-imagining of the classic H.G. Wells' novel.[2]

In this new take on War Of The Worlds, when astronomers detect a transmission from another star, it is definitive proof of intelligent extra-terrestrial life. Earth's population waits for further contact with bated breath, but does not have to wait long. Within days, mankind is all but wiped out, with just pockets of humanity are left in an eerily deserted world. As alien ships appear in the sky, the survivors ask a burning question — who are these attackers and why are they hell-bent on our destruction?

Episodes

No.TitleDirected byWritten byOriginal French air date
1Episode 1Gilles CoulierHoward OvermanOctober 28, 2019 (2019-10-28)
Astronomer Catherine Durand detects a strong signal from Ross 128 which is of intelligent origin. Soon afterwards a large group of meteors impacts the centers of all major inhabited areas of Earth. They are indeed metallic spacecraft. They start emitting a magnetic signal which quickly kills all unsheltered humans. In London Sarah Gresham fights to save her children Tom and Emily, while her husband Jonathan is in Paris and desperately tries to get home. Emily hears strange sounds. Bill tries to warn his son Dan and to save his ex-wife Helen. Kariem finds himself alone in a strange environment. Catherine's sister Sophia tries to reach her at the observatory.
2Episode 2Gilles CoulierHoward OvermanOctober 28, 2019 (2019-10-28)
In London, in Paris and in the French Alps, the survivors try to reach their loved ones, walking among the dead and wondering about the motives of the invaders. Both Helen and Sarah find it hard to grasp this new reality. Tom and Emily struggle to understand their mother's behaviour. Jonathan decides to make his way alone back to England. Neuroscientist Bill finds the alien methods mindboggling. Kariem makes some bad decisions based on fear. Catherine despairs in the search for her sister Sophia. In a Grenoble supermarket Catherine, colonel Mokrani and a group of French soldiers have a first encounter with quadrupedal lethal cyborgs.
3Episode 3Gilles CoulierHoward OvermanNovember 4, 2019 (2019-11-04)
Helen and Bill arrive too late in the command center. They manage to incapacitate a quadruped bot and make a discovery about its nature. Sarah and her children meet Ash and provide help in a hospital. Emily temporarily recovers her sight and befriends Kariem. Catherine is in shock when she finds out what role she and her colleagues played in the alien attack. Jonathan meets Chloe and they head north together.
4Episode 4Gilles CoulierHoward OvermanNovember 4, 2019 (2019-11-04)
Catherine finds the source of the sounds and Colonel Mokrani and his team go out to investigate. Ash makes a very tough decision while Kariem saves lives. Sarah and her children have a close encounter with a cyborg. Sacha finds a meteor site and hears strange noises. Helen and Bill are determined to find a way to destroy all quadruped bots. Kariem and Emily bond. Chloe has to confront her past. Ash and Kariem return to the hospital and are startled by their finds.
5Episode 5Richard ClarkHoward OvermanNovember 11, 2019 (2019-11-11)
Patches of survivors find each other and team up. They all try to find a way to cope with their situation. Bill finds a student in Tom. Emily feels a strange connection with the alien invaders. Chloe and Sacha struggle to cope with their emotions. The fight intensifies as we find out what the quadruped bots are after. Jonathan is baffled by Sacha's behaviour. Colonel Mokrani and his team make some interesting discoveries. Catherine has a close shave.
6Episode 6Richard ClarkHoward OvermanNovember 11, 2019 (2019-11-11)
Emily's sight recovers as she hears the noise. Bill is intrigued by her connection to the cyborgs, others question it. Sacha discovers he has a connection to the cyborgs too and Jonathan finds his behaviour very hard to understand. In London the group of survivors make their way to the university lab where Bill and Tom try to gain information on the quadrupeds. They find the aliens know more about humans than they imagined possible. Emily clashes with her mother. Helen and Sarah take a gamble and end up in a precarious situation. Tom's birthday needs celebrating and everybody reconciles. Catherine and Mokrani's team return to the observatory where a surprise awaits them.
7Episode 7Richard ClarkHoward OvermanNovember 18, 2019 (2019-11-18)
We see how Sophia survived the first few days. The situation between Jonathan and Sacha reaches boiling point. Bill tries to get information from Emily but she feels more confused than ever. Catherine's priorities have changed now Sophia is alive. She develops a theory around the alien noise. Helen finds out about Bill's secret. The future looks very different for the London group when disaster strikes.
8Episode 8Richard ClarkHoward OvermanNovember 18, 2019 (2019-11-18)
Catherine, Sophia and Mokrani's team go looking for other survivors. Ash doubts Emily's motives while Bill wrestles with his new reality. Jonathan learns the truth about Sacha and Chloe. Emily and Kariem go looking for answers. Sacha decides to follow Jonathan to England in hope of meeting his daughter. Catherine puts her theory to the test.

Production

Development

War of the Worlds is produced by Fox Networks Group and StudioCanal.[5][6] AGC Television co-finances and co-distributes the series.[2]

Gilles Coulier and Richard Clark each directed four episodes of the series, with Coulier directing the first four episode and Clark directing the last four.[7] The series was written by Howard Overman.[7] The series is executive produced by Overman, Julian Murphy and Johnny Capps.[8] By October 2019, the creative team had begun work on a second season.[1]

Casting

Gabriel Byrne and Elizabeth McGovern star in the series, and they are joined by Daisy Edgar-Jones, Stéphane Caillard, Adel Bencherif, Guillaume Gouix, Léa Drucker and Natasha Little.[3] Greg Kinnear was originally set to star, but was not listed in the starring cast list when it was revealed by Deadline Hollywood in January 2019.[2]

Filming

Production for series 1 took place in the United Kingdom, France and Belgium.[2][9] The series was filmed in Bristol in March 2019,[10] as well as filming in Cardiff, Newport and London.[9][11]

Series 2 began filming on July 13, 2020.[12]

Release

The first series was released in full on MyCanal in France on October 28, 2019,[2][13] before being broadcast from October 28 in weekly batches of two episodes,[14][15] and was released in most parts of Europe and Africa weekly between October 30 and December 18, 2019.[16][17] On November 21, 2019, it was announced that the series is set to premiere in the United States on February 16, 2020 on Epix.[18] The series is scheduled to be broadcast in the UK on March 5, 2020.[19]

Canal+ and Fox Networks Group have the rights to release the series in Europe and Africa. AGC Television distribute the series to the North American market, and co-distribute with StudioCanal to Latin America, Asia, Australia, New Zealand, and the Middle East. Fox Networks Group release the series in Europe.[2][6] The series broadcasts on Fox in more than 50 countries.[7]
